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. The length of time does it take to obtain a French driving license?

The period can vary substantially but usually takes around 3 to 6 months from the application date to receiving the license if all tests are handed down the first effort.

2. Can I drive in France with my foreign driving license?

Yes, as a tourist or short-lived citizen, you can drive with a valid foreign driving license. Nevertheless, if you are becoming an irreversible resident, you might need to exchange your foreign license for a French one.

3. What do I do if I stop working the driving test?

If you do not pass the driving test, there is usually a waiting period of a couple of weeks before you can retake the examination. Utilize this time to practice the areas where you had a hard time and think about extra lessons from a driving school.

4. Exist any exemptions for EU people?

EU residents can frequently exchange their driving licenses for a French one without retaking a test, provided their license is valid and up-to-date.

5. Do I require to discover French to pass the driving test?

Understanding of French is beneficial, particularly for understanding the theory examination. Nevertheless, some driving schools provide courses in English or available translations.
